DJ FUNKMASTER FLEX INDUCTED INTO THE NEW YORK BROADCASTERS HALL OF FAME

DJ FUNKMASTER FLEX
The inductees for the 2013 New York Broadcasters Hall of Fame have been announced and Hot 97′s Funkmaster Flex is part of the class.
Please join us in saluting this accomplishment of a DJ who has been working at Hot 97 since the ’90s. What makes this such an extraordinary feat is that he is the first Hip-Hop DJ to do so.

In addition to radio, Flex has been dubbed the “evangelist of Hip Hop car culture” by the New York Times. He is also known for breaking exclusive records with his signature bomb drops that hype up any track. One of his biggest assets is that he plays a very pivotal part in artist exposure with his show reaching up to 3 million listeners a week. 
Flex’s influence extends far beyond his ability to rock a crowd and transcend his skills throughout the decades as a DJ. He’s one of hip-hop’s most respected personalities and is asked his opinion on the state of affairs in hip-hop at many rap forums frequently. These forums often include the likes of heavyweights executives such as Russell Simmons, Lyor Cohen, and Rick Rubin just to name a few.
